Is It “Really” Illegal to be Gay in Libya?

We don’t have a law but we have a culture that is strongly opposed to liberties such as women’s freedoms and premarital sex. The country’s criminal code prohibits all sexual activity outside of a lawful marriage. Under Article 410 of the Libyan Penal Code, Private homosexual acts between consenting adults are illegal.
